Bug 209443 - plasma-desktop crashed after removing widgets from panel
Summary: plasma-desktop crashed after removing widgets from panel
Status: RESOLVED DUPLICATE of bug 200847
Alias: None
Product: plasma4
Classification: Plasma
Component: general (show other bugs)
Version: unspecified
Platform: Unlisted Binaries Linux
: NOR crash
Target Milestone: ---
Assignee: Plasma Bugs List
URL:
Keywords:
Depends on:
Blocks:
 
Reported: 2009-10-04 21:19 UTC by Dave Ulrick
Modified: 2009-10-05 12:24 UTC (History)
2 users (show)

See Also:
Latest Commit:
Version Fixed In:


Attachments

Note You need to log in before you can comment on or make changes to this bug.
Description Dave Ulrick 2009-10-04 21:19:07 UTC
Application that crashed: plasma-desktop
Version of the application: 0.3
KDE Version: 4.3.1 (KDE 4.3.1)
Qt Version: 4.5.2
Operating System: Linux 2.6.27.30-170.2.82.fc10.i686 i686
Distribution: "Fedora release 10 (Cambridge)"

What I was doing when the application crashed:
plasma-desktop crashed and restarted after I performed this sequence of operations:

1.  Unlocked widgets.

2.  Removed System CPU Monitor plasmoid from Panel.

3.  Removed LCD Weather Station plasmoid from Panel.

4.  Locked widgets.

5.  Switched to another desktop.


 -- Backtrace:
Application: Plasma Workspace (plasma-desktop), signal: Segmentation fault
[Current thread is 1 (Thread 0xb80717a0 (LWP 22692))]

Thread 2 (Thread 0xacf4cb90 (LWP 22693)):
#0  0x003d9416 in __kernel_vsyscall ()
#1  0x00486105 in pthread_cond_wait@@GLIBC_2.3.2 () from /lib/libpthread.so.0
#2  0x07077362 in QWaitConditionPrivate::wait () at thread/qwaitcondition_unix.cpp:87
#3  QWaitCondition::wait (this=0x9af2560, mutex=0x9af255c, time=4294967295) at thread/qwaitcondition_unix.cpp:159
#4  0x073298f2 in QHostInfoAgent::run (this=0x9af2550) at kernel/qhostinfo.cpp:260
#5  0x07076322 in QThreadPrivate::start (arg=0x9af2550) at thread/qthread_unix.cpp:188
#6  0x0048251f in start_thread (arg=0xacf4cb90) at pthread_create.c:297
#7  0x057a204e in clone () at ../sysdeps/unix/sysv/linux/i386/clone.S:130

Thread 1 (Thread 0xb80717a0 (LWP 22692)):
[KCrash Handler]
#6  0x03f93caa in QGraphicsItem::isWidget (this=0x9a76790) at graphicsview/qgraphicsitem.cpp:1142
#7  0x03fcd9f7 in QGraphicsScene::event (this=0x98f6748, event=0xbf81b580) at graphicsview/qgraphicsscene.cpp:3850
#8  0x0398e9ac in QApplicationPrivate::notify_helper (this=0x97c7670, receiver=0x98f6748, e=0xbf81b580) at kernel/qapplication.cpp:4056
#9  0x03996cbe in QApplication::notify (this=0x97c3838, receiver=0x98f6748, e=0xbf81b580) at kernel/qapplication.cpp:3603
#10 0x01141ebd in KApplication::notify () from /usr/lib/libkdeui.so.5
#11 0x0716af7b in QCoreApplication::notifyInternal (this=0x97c3838, receiver=0x98f6748, event=0xbf81b580) at kernel/qcoreapplication.cpp:610
#12 0x03fdfde5 in QCoreApplication::sendEvent (event=<value optimized out>, receiver=0x9d75a80) at ../../src/corelib/kernel/qcoreapplication.h:213
#13 QGraphicsView::viewportEvent (this=0x9d75a80, event=0xbf81b580) at graphicsview/qgraphicsview.cpp:2880
#14 0x03e37555 in QAbstractScrollAreaPrivate::viewportEvent () at widgets/qabstractscrollarea_p.h:100
#15 QAbstractScrollAreaFilter::eventFilter (this=0x9d776a0, o=0x9d77778, e=0xbf81b580) at widgets/qabstractscrollarea_p.h:111
#16 0x0716a19a in QCoreApplicationPrivate::sendThroughObjectEventFilters (this=0x97c7670, receiver=0x9d77778, event=0xbf81b580) at kernel/qcoreapplication.cpp:726
#17 0x0398e98a in QApplicationPrivate::notify_helper (this=0x97c7670, receiver=0x9d77778, e=0xbf81b580) at kernel/qapplication.cpp:4052
#18 0x03996da2 in QApplication::notify (this=0x97c3838, receiver=0x9d77778, e=0xbf81b580) at kernel/qapplication.cpp:4021
#19 0x01141ebd in KApplication::notify () from /usr/lib/libkdeui.so.5
#20 0x0716af7b in QCoreApplication::notifyInternal (this=0x97c3838, receiver=0x9d77778, event=0xbf81b580) at kernel/qcoreapplication.cpp:610
#21 0x039e508d in QCoreApplication::sendEvent (event=<value optimized out>, receiver=0x9d75a80) at ../../src/corelib/kernel/qcoreapplication.h:213
#22 QWidget::event (this=0x9d75a80, event=0xbf81b580) at kernel/qwidget.cpp:7797
#23 0x03d94de3 in QFrame::event (this=0x9d75a80, e=0xbf81b580) at widgets/qframe.cpp:559
#24 0x03e35a4d in QAbstractScrollArea::event (this=0x9d75a80, e=0xbf81b580) at widgets/qabstractscrollarea.cpp:918
#25 0x03fdca16 in QGraphicsView::event (this=0x9d75a80, event=0xbf81b580) at graphicsview/qgraphicsview.cpp:2840
#26 0x0398e9ac in QApplicationPrivate::notify_helper (this=0x97c7670, receiver=0x9d75a80, e=0xbf81b580) at kernel/qapplication.cpp:4056
#27 0x03996da2 in QApplication::notify (this=0x97c3838, receiver=0x9d75a80, e=0xbf81b580) at kernel/qapplication.cpp:4021
#28 0x01141ebd in KApplication::notify () from /usr/lib/libkdeui.so.5
#29 0x0716af7b in QCoreApplication::notifyInternal (this=0x97c3838, receiver=0x9d75a80, event=0xbf81b580) at kernel/qcoreapplication.cpp:610
#30 0x039958b1 in QCoreApplication::sendSpontaneousEvent (event=<value optimized out>, receiver=0x9d75a80) at ../../src/corelib/kernel/qcoreapplication.h:216
#31 QApplication::setActiveWindow (act=0x9d75a80) at kernel/qapplication.cpp:2414
#32 0x03a051fd in QApplication::x11ProcessEvent (this=0x97c3838, event=0xbf81cacc) at kernel/qapplication_x11.cpp:3464
#33 0x03a2f52a in x11EventSourceDispatch (s=0x97ca0a8, callback=0, user_data=0x0) at kernel/qguieventdispatcher_glib.cpp:146
#34 0x0894c258 in g_main_dispatch () at gmain.c:2144
#35 IA__g_main_context_dispatch (context=0x97c96a0) at gmain.c:2697
#36 0x0894f903 in g_main_context_iterate (context=0x97c96a0, block=1, dispatch=1, self=0x97c70e0) at gmain.c:2778
#37 0x0894fac1 in IA__g_main_context_iteration (context=0x97c96a0, may_block=1) at gmain.c:2841
#38 0x07196808 in QEventDispatcherGlib::processEvents (this=0x97c73a0, flags={i = 36}) at kernel/qeventdispatcher_glib.cpp:327
#39 0x03a2ec25 in QGuiEventDispatcherGlib::processEvents (this=0x97c73a0, flags={i = 36}) at kernel/qguieventdispatcher_glib.cpp:202
#40 0x071695aa in QEventLoop::processEvents (this=0xbf81cd30, flags={i = 36}) at kernel/qeventloop.cpp:149
#41 0x071699f2 in QEventLoop::exec (this=0xbf81cd30, flags={i = 0}) at kernel/qeventloop.cpp:201
#42 0x0716be99 in QCoreApplication::exec () at kernel/qcoreapplication.cpp:888
#43 0x0398e827 in QApplication::exec () at kernel/qapplication.cpp:3525
#44 0x00f36d20 in ?? ()
#45 0x097c3838 in ?? ()
#46 0xbf81cdcc in ?? ()
#47 0xbf81ce18 in ?? ()
#48 0xbf81cdd0 in ?? ()
#49 0xbf81cdd4 in ?? ()
#50 0xbf81ce10 in ?? ()
#51 0x00000001 in ?? ()
#52 0xbf81ce0c in ?? ()
#53 0xbf81cdfc in ?? ()
#54 0xbf81cdf8 in ?? ()
#55 0xbf81cdf4 in ?? ()
#56 0x07076c3e in report_error (code=0, where=0x0, what=0x1 <Address 0x1 out of bounds>) at thread/qwaitcondition_unix.cpp:58
#57 0x08048702 in _start ()

Reported using DrKonqi
Comment 1 Dario Andres 2009-10-04 22:04:33 UTC
This crash is probably bug 200847.
- Does Plasma crash again if you repeat the steps you described ? (I tried here at 4.4trunk and I couldn't reproduce the crash).
If you can reproduce, can you detail how are you switching desktop? (using the pager applet?, using some shortcut?)
Thanks
Comment 2 Beat Wolf 2009-10-05 12:24:58 UTC

*** This bug has been marked as a duplicate of bug 200847 ***